The Human Resources Manager is a fascinating mix of comedy and drama, you know? The film really digs into this awkward yet earnest HR manager who’s trying to spin a narrative in a world that feels heavy with absurdity. Set against the backdrop of an industrial bakery, it creates this unique atmosphere—part mundane, part chaotic. The pacing is intriguing; it ebbs and flows, matching the protagonist's frantic attempts to clear the company's name. The performances stand out, especially the lead, who embodies this blend of desperation and determination. It’s a film that reflects on reputation and the lengths one goes to preserve it, with a kind of dry humor that sneaks up on you. Definitely something different.
